Job Overview

The Senior Markets Legal Negotiator - Vice President is a senior level, non‑attorney role, responsible for representing the Legal Function in providing Transaction Management expertise to Citi's businesses and functions. The Transaction Management area is responsible for the negotiation, transaction processes, documentation, and execution of business transactions – working closely with internal clients as well as Sales and Relationship Managers and Citi Product Legal Counsel in negotiating, reviewing and analysing legal documentation for the key businesses we support.

The successful individual will work on drafting and negotiating a broad range of both standard and complex derivatives documentation for primarily the Corporate Social Governance, Local Markets, Limited Risk Distributor, Foreign Exchange and Rates businesses. This role requires a pragmatic, proactive professional with a thorough understanding of the business covered by the team and its products and services, as well as a deep knowledge of the contractual terms and legal implications of Citi's documentation. Excellent communication and diplomacy skills are required as this role advises Citi businesses in discussions on the various contractual provisions, including the risks of modifying or amending such terms.


Responsibilities

* Negotiating and reviewing legal agreements with internal/external customers to reach agreement on the contents of the Bank’s legal documentation, using telephone, electronic negotiation and lock‑in sessions or client meetings as required.
* Maintaining close liaison with internal businesses and London Legal to negotiate legal agreements in the relevant business area, ensuring prioritisation aligns with overall desk goals.
* Interpreting key commercial concepts from a range of trading agreements (Credit Support Annexes, Termination Agreements, Counterparty Guarantees and ancillary documentation) and incorporating them into EMEA‑specific documentation, accounting for regulatory or jurisdictional changes.
* Applying in‑depth knowledge of how associated risks differ by product and documentation and advising Risk and Business accordingly.
* Ensuring compliance with Citi’s internal and regulatory policies, and obtaining necessary risk or business approvals when deviations are required.
* Contributing to process improvements by liaising with internal stakeholders such as Technology, Risk, Client Risk Facilitation, Client Onboarding, Regulatory Reform, Operations and Legal.
* Implementing governance and control checks during the documentation process and proactively identifying and escalating issues.
* Understanding the impact of applicable regulations on the business area and ensuring agreements meet those regulatory requirements.
* Problem‑solving to facilitate solutions that enable technology systems and legal documentation to support client offerings, participating in technology development discussions when solutions are requested or proposed.
* Assisting with knowledge sharing, preparing know‑how manuals, and providing support or training to team members as required.
* Complying with internal and external audit requests, including supplying client documentation and other relevant information within specified timeframes.
